Ranil Wickremesinghe Moved from Prison Hospital to NHSL

Former President Ranil Wickremesinghe, who is currently in remand custody, will be transferred to the National Hospital in Colombo on medical advice, prison officials confirmed.

Wickremesinghe was earlier admitted to the Prison Hospital after being diagnosed with high blood pressure and elevated blood sugar levels. Prison Media Spokesperson and Commissioner Jagath Weerasinghe stated that his request to receive meals from home due to health reasons had already been granted.

The decision to move the former President from the Prison Hospital to the National Hospital was taken following further medical recommendations.
